Description The Navy's presidential flag from 1882, the year it was designed. This was the first official flag specifically for the president; the basic design was the Great Seal of the United States on a blue field (several other nations used the national coat of arms on the flag of their head of state). It was not a completely faithful Great Seal; the eagle is in all white and thirteen stars in an arc were used instead of the regular crest. The Army had their own presidential flag starting in 1898, and both were replaced in 1916.
